Festinger, Schachter, and Back (1950) traced friendship formations among couples in an apartment complex at MIT. They found that

residents were most likely to be friends with people __________.

Answer:

They found that residents were most likely to be friends with people who lived closer to them.

Explanation:

In their study, Festinger, Schachter, and Back required residents to identify their three closest friends in an apartment complex. As it was predicted by the propinquity effect, sixty-five percent of friends they named lived in the same building, no matter the distance to other buildings. And this was only one of many examples. In this way, these three researchers proved that propinquity is based both in physical and functional distance.

Where did Poe attend college?
GuDViN [60]
I assume that the question refers to Edgar Allan Poe - the American writer, critic and editor. 

- he went to the University of Virginia. However, he did not graduate and he left the college after one semester due to the lack of money.  After this, he enlisted in the Army.
